Bombay HC raises concerns over e-voting provisions
Description
The Bombay high court has raised concern over e-voting provisions of the new Companies Act 2013. The court says that some companies are interpreting the provision for e-voting as a way to do away with shareholder meetings. Mint's Ashish Rukhaiyar reports
